sqlite修复工具
SQLite是一款开源、轻量级的数据库管理系统,广泛应用于嵌入式设备、移动应用以及服务器端。SQLite数据库文件的损坏或丢失可能会导致数据无法访问,此时就需要SQLite修复工具来帮助恢复数据。本文将深入探讨SQLite数据库的基本原理,分析可能引发数据库损坏的原因,并详细介绍如何使用专业的SQLite修复工具进行数据恢复。 SQLite数据库采用自包含、无服务器、事务性的SQL数据库引擎。它的设计目标是实现零配置、跨平台、快速启动和高效运行。数据库文件本质上是一个普通的磁盘文件,包含了所有的表、索引、触发器和视图等数据结构。正因为如此,SQLite数据库文件容易受到各种因素的影响,如系统崩溃、硬件故障、病毒感染或人为误操作,从而导致文件损坏。 SQLite修复工具通常具备以下功能: 1. 扫描SQLite数据库文件:专业的SQLite修复工具首先会扫描受损的SQLite数据库文件,查找可恢复的数据。 2. 分析数据结构:工具会解析数据库文件中的页和记录,重建表和索引的结构。 3. 恢复数据:在分析基础上,工具将尝试恢复尽可能多的记录,包括文本、数字和二进制数据。 4. 验证恢复结果:工具会在恢复过程中进行数据验证,确保恢复的数据完整性。 5. 输出恢复数据:用户可以选择将恢复的数据导出到新的SQLite数据库文件,以便于后续使用。 使用SQLite修复工具的一般步骤如下: 1. 下载并安装合适的SQLite修复工具,如SQLite Recovery Professional 3。 2. 运行工具,选择要修复的SQLite数据库文件。 3. 工具会自动扫描文件,用户可以通过进度条和错误报告了解扫描状态。 4. 扫描完成后,工具会列出可恢复的表和记录,用户可以预览数据以确认恢复效果。 5. 选择保存恢复数据的位置,创建一个新的SQLite数据库文件。 6. 验证新数据库文件是否能正常连接和查询数据。 需要注意的是,尽管SQLite修复工具能够帮助恢复大部分数据,但并不能保证100%成功。在实际使用中,为了最大化保护数据安全,应定期备份重要的SQLite数据库,以防止数据丢失。此外,如果数据库文件在损坏前有事务日志,那么使用SQLite的wal模式或journal模式可能有助于减少数据丢失的风险。 SQLite修复工具是应对SQLite数据库损坏情况的有效解决方案。通过理解其工作原理和使用方法,可以更好地应对数据恢复挑战,保护珍贵的信息资源。
- 1
- 失控yxy2015-03-18真的假的,好纠结
- skyoocat2015-11-30不是很好用。。本来是拿来修复SVN的库的。没成功。但用工具可以查看到,所以我也不知道到底是成功了还是没成功。
- sinat_275456472018-12-01只看到了SQLite的安装文件,没有修复工具
- littlemartin2015-03-18不是很好用,没有修复我的数据库,后来下了别的工具才搞定
- 阳光下的稻田2015-04-21修复不成功。。我也是使用别的工具。。。
- 粉丝: 10
- 资源: 2
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- YOLOv8完整网络结构图详细visio
- LCD1602电子时钟程序
- 西北太平洋热带气旋【灾害风险统计】及【登陆我国次数评估】数据集-1980-2023
- 全球干旱数据集【自校准帕尔默干旱程度指数scPDSI】-190101-202312-0.5x0.5
- 基于Python实现的VAE(变分自编码器)训练算法源代码+使用说明
- 全球干旱数据集【标准化降水蒸发指数SPEI-12】-190101-202312-0.5x0.5
- C语言小游戏-五子棋-详细代码可运行
- 全球干旱数据集【标准化降水蒸发指数SPEI-03】-190101-202312-0.5x0.5
- spring boot aop记录修改前后的值demo
- 全球干旱数据集【标准化降水蒸发指数SPEI-01】-190101-202312-0.5x0.5